The Anatomy of a Premium Finish
A high-quality carbon fiber finish is composed of several distinct layers, each with a specific chemical role. It begins with the epoxy resin that saturates the carbon fibers. While this resin provides the structural bond, it is not designed to be the final surface. On top of the resin, we apply multiple layers of high-solids clear coat. This clear coat is the “skin” of the part, providing the depth and gloss that enthusiasts crave.
The clear coats we use at Carbonss Tuning are not standard automotive paints. They are specialized, high-performance formulations designed specifically for the unique requirements of composite materials. They must be flexible enough to handle the expansion and contraction of the carbon fiber while being hard enough to resist scratches and environmental etching. Most importantly, they must be chemically engineered to block UV radiation before it can reach the sensitive resin underneath.
The Chemistry of UV Blocking
UV radiation exists in several bands, with UV-A and UV-B being the most damaging to polymers. To combat these rays, we incorporate two primary types of chemical additives into our clear coats:
- UV Absorbers (UVA): These molecules act like a “chemical sunscreen.” They are designed to catch UV photons and convert their energy into low-level heat. This prevented the UV energy from breaking the polymer chains in the clear coat and the underlying resin.
- Hindered Amine Light Stabilizers (HALS): While absorbers block incoming rays, HALS deal with the damage that does manage to occur. When a polymer chain is broken by UV light, it creates a “free radical”—a highly reactive molecule that can trigger a chain reaction of degradation. HALS act as “radical scavengers,” neutralizing these molecules and effectively “healing” the chemical structure of the finish.
By using a synergistic combination of UVAs and HALS, we create a multi-tiered defense system that is significantly more effective than standard clear coats. Achieving the Mirror Finish: The Finishing Process
The chemistry is only half the battle; the application is the other. Achieving a true mirror finish requires a meticulous, multi-stage process that we have refined over many years:
- Precision Spraying: We use high-volume, low-pressure (HVLP) spray systems in a climate-controlled environment to apply the clear coat. This ensuring a perfectly even thickness across the entire part, which is essential for uniform UV protection and optical clarity.
- Heat-Accelerated Curing: After application, the parts are cured in a specialized oven. This “cross-linking” process creates a denser, more durable chemical bond within the clear coat, making it more resistant to chemicals and scratches.
- Multi-Stage Wet Sanding: To achieve that mirror-like surface, every part is hand-sanded using progressively finer grits of sandpaper, ranging from 1000 up to 3000 grit. This removes any “orange peel” or surface imperfections.
- Machine Polishing: The final stage is a three-step machine polishing process using premium compounds. This brings out the deep gloss and ensures that the “Distinctness of Image” (DOI) is at a world-class level.
Key Performance Metrics
We believe in data-driven quality. Here are the performance metrics that define our advanced finishing process:
- Clear Coat Thickness: We maintain a consistent clear coat thickness of 60-80 microns, providing a deep, sacrificial layer that can be safely polished multiple times over the life of the part.
- Pencil Hardness: Our cured finishes achieve a 4H hardness rating on the pencil scale, offering superior resistance to car wash swirls and light environmental debris.
- UV Absorption Percentage: Our clear coat system is engineered to block over 99.5% of UV radiation in the 280-400nm range, effectively shielding the structural resin.
- DOI (Distinctness of Image): Carbonss Tuning parts achieve a DOI score of over 95 (out of 100), meaning the reflection is as sharp and clear as a high-quality glass mirror.
- Chemical Resistance: Our finishes are tested to resist common automotive chemicals, including gasoline, brake fluid, and bird droppings, for up to 24 hours without staining or softening.
